Output 1fbbf66e960767d1440dfc1a34a49a5bd7e596427dd6a6eba1f2916355fcfb13:4

value
2180691
script pubkey
OP_0 OP_PUSHBYTES_20 8e07bbde4ae9028ce8c739fe8128722a93d96fc9
address
bc1q3crmhhj2aypge6x888lgz2rj92fajm7fdjcawf
transaction
1fbbf66e960767d1440dfc1a34a49a5bd7e596427dd6a6eba1f2916355fcfb13